WebAs mentioned before, the two most common aspect ratios are 4:3, also known as 1.33:1 or fullscreen, and 16:9, also known as 1.78:1 or widescreen. WebSep 20, 2004 · Matthew Chmiel. If it was filmed in Super35 then you lose picture on the sides on foolscreen,but you lose picture on the top/bottom in widescreen. Super35 has a negative aspect ratio of 1.33:1. During filming, the DP usually frames the film in a 2.35:1 ratio (few films shot in Super35 are not 2.35:1).
